Rufi In My Wine -Abridged Version-

I let an opportunist within my circle of trust

He slipped a rufi in my wine
I was too naïve to question 
my sudden lapse of memory

I tremble at what might have been

I was like putty in his hands
it happened so easily
I was so naïve

My destiny was in the hands of
someone who could not be trusted
my luck hanging on a string
